

In 1956 his parents migrated to the United States. George was the oldest of two sons, his brother Richard Gutierrez was born on July 27, 1956 in Los Angeles, California. George graduated from Salesian High School. At the age of 18 he was drafted into the Army. He was stationed in Fort Carson, Colorado, among other places. He served for nearly two years as an active duty soldier during the Vietnam War. He took some College courses earning himself an Associates Degree. He was a Police Officer for the Los Angeles Police Department. A knee injury ended his Police career. After that he worked for Gears Automotive. He eventually began working for Los Angeles Department of Water and Power in the Personnel Department. He then became a reprographics operator, retiring in 2016. At some point in his life, he married his first wife Patricia Valdez Gutierrez. They had one daughter and two sons together. George met the love of his life Eula R. O'Quin in 1988, while him and Patricia were separated. In 1991, his youngest daughter Crystal was born on December 12. George took care of his daughter Christine's twins for nine months. He had legal guardianship of Christine's other daughter Precious. In 2004, he had his right kidney removed due to a non-cancerous tumor until 2016, when it began to fail just before he retired. He was placed on emergency dialysis and transplant list for a kidney. George was next on the list before the Covid-19 pandemic began. He needed an aortic valve replacement to continue forward with the transplant process. In September 2021, he was hospitalized to undergo open heart surgery to replace his aortic valve. He remained hospitalized for the majority of September 2021. On the road to recovery he developed two infections; a gallbladder and stomach infections. These infections entered his bloodstream, known as sepsis, which ultimately caused his death on October 7th, 2021.
George leaves behind his Domestic Partner Eula R. O'Quin, a daughter; Crystal Gutierrez, granddaughter; Precious Gutierrez, grandson-in-law; Hairo Zamora who lived with him. He also leaves behind a brother; Richard Gutierrez, three children from his first marriage to Patricia Valdez; Christine Gutierrez, George Albert Gutierrez Jr. and James (Jimmy) Gutierrez, fifteen other grandchildren and nine great grandchildren. George will be missed by family members and friends.
